Relive Organ Inaugural Concerts on Minnesota Public Radio's Pipedreams; Program Broadcast Locally on WCLV April 14

By Marci Janas ‘91

 

 

 

Pipedreams, the nationally distributed Minnesota Public Radio program hosted by Michael Barone '68, will showcase Oberlin's Kay Africa Memorial Organ, C.B. Fisk Opus 116, during the week of April 8 with excerpts from the inaugural concerts.

Included in the program will be works by Ermend Bonnal, Joseph Jongen, Olivier Messiaen, Camille Saint-Saëns, Robert Sirota '71, Louis Vierne, and Louis James Alfred Lefébure-Wély.

Local listeners can hear the Oberlin Pipedreams program when it is broadcast on WCLV-104.9 FM on Sunday, April 14, at 10 p.m.
